  • Settlements and Verdicts: Dow Corning.
    The $2.35 billion in settlement funds which were agreed upon nine years ago will finally be paid out, staring as soon as June 15. The suit was filed on behalf of 170,000 women in reference to damages suffered due to breast implants. Settlements will range from $2,000 to $330,000 per person.   • Settlements and Verdicts: Medco Health Solutions Inc.
    A $29 million settlement has been reached in the lawsuit filed by 20 states. The suit alleged that the company pressured doctors to change patients' medications to benefit its bottom line.   • Settlements and Verdicts: Weyerhaeuser.
    A $34.5 million settlement has been reached in the antitrust lawsuit filed by Cascade Hardwood in Chehalis, Alexander Lumber Mill in Onalaska, Westwood Lumber in Reedsport, Ore., and Morton Alder Mill in Willamina, Ore.   • Settlements and Verdicts: International Flavors & Fragrances Inc.
    An $18 million verdict has been reached in the lawsuit filed by Eric Peoples, who worked at the Gilster-Mary Lee popcorn plant in Jasper, MO from October 1997 to March 1999.   • Settlements and Verdicts: The City of New York.
    A $10 million settlement has been reached in several lawsuits filed by advocates for the homeless. The city will pay $150 a night to each of an estimated 12,500 families who, since January 1995, spent the night without beds at the Bronx Emergency Assistance Unit.
